Context
Released on November 17, 2017, 'Rest' is Charlotte Gainsbourg's first album in seven years, following her acclaimed 2010 album 'IRM'. This period marked a significant evolution in her career as she navigated personal loss, specifically the death of her mother, which deeply influenced the album's themes and emotional depth.

'Rest' received critical acclaim for its poignant exploration of grief and identity, landing on numerous year-end lists. It showcases Gainsbourg's ability to merge personal narrative with innovative sound, reinforcing her status as a prominent figure in alternative music.
